julia
Fix llvm-assertion: don't instantiate 0-sized structs (ghost types)
#31431
Merged

Fix llvm-assertion: don't instantiate 0-sized structs (ghost types) #31431

NHDaly
NHDaly Fix llvm-assertion: don't load ghost types
0d0b8539
NHDaly
vtjnash
vtjnash commented on 2019-03-21
vtjnash
JeffBezanson JeffBezanson added compiler:codegen
JeffBezanson JeffBezanson added bugfix
vtjnash Apply vtjnash's suggested change to src/intrinsics.cpp
8df4de4b
NHDaly Apply vtjnash's suggestion to src/intrinsics.cpp
d0b0ca3c
NHDaly
NHDaly Add test for Issue #29929: `unsafe_store!(::Ptr{Nothing}, ::Nothing)`
37250720
NHDaly More tests: can load/store any 0-sized struct
33c15d30
NHDaly
JeffBezanson
JeffBezanson approved these changes on 2019-03-25
StefanKarpinski
vchuravy vchuravy merged 92a361be into master 7 years ago
JeffBezanson
NHDaly NHDaly deleted the nhdaly-llvm-ghost-types branch 7 years ago
vchuravy

Login to write a write a comment.

Login via GitHub

Reviewers
Assignees
No one assigned
Labels
Milestone